Silicon Valley, “Runaway Devaluation” (Sunday, April 18, 10/9c, HBO)

Last week’s Silicon Valley premiere was all about reluctant entrepreneur Richard (Thomas Middleditch) and the boys getting their well-deserved, if brief and uncomfortable, view from the top while their app, Pied Piper, was one the best investment opportunities in town. But that’s all kaput now that evil billionaire Gavin Belson (Matt Ross) is suing them. It’s now time for their precipitous fall—and those valleys are low.

All is not lost, however. The stress brings out the best comic kvetching yet among Richard’s bickering buddies Dinesh (unrelenting scene-stealer Kumail Nanjiani) and Gilfoyle (Martin Starr). When Dinesh realizes he won’t have the cash to cover the $5,000 he foolishly pledged to his cousin’s Kickstarter campaign for a ridiculous app that texts “bro” to your friends, he scrambles to make sure the latter can’t make his fundraising goal—but not as fast as Gilfoyle scrambles to help the boy hit it. May the worst man win!
